Relay-Version: version B 2.10 5/3/83; site utzoo.UUCP Posting-Version: $Revision: 1.6.2.14 $; site siemens.UUCP Path: utzoo!watmath!clyde!burl!ulysses!allegra!princeton!siemens!jar From: jar@siemens.UUCP Newsgroups: net.rec.photo Subject: Re: Telephoto Zoom lens Message-ID: <24800001@siemens.UUCP> Date: Thu, 9-Jan-86 08:55:00 EST Article-I.D.: siemens.24800001 Posted: Thu Jan 9 08:55:00 1986 Date-Received: Fri, 10-Jan-86 23:32:40 EST References: <203@hropus.UUCP> Lines: 20 Nf-ID: #R:hropus:-20300:siemens:24800001:000:670 Nf-From: siemens!jar Jan 9 08:55:00 1986 I have the Pentax ME (without super) and only the Tokina SMZ 35-105 (3.5-4.3). I heavily used them the last 4 years (about 5000 slides have been made in that time). The quality is very satisfying for me but not in the macro distance (pillow and barrel effects) which I knew before I bought it. It was the only one of that kind in those days. And after 4 years? There is only one small problem now: It zooms automatically if the camera faces the floor which can be bad in some cases (this effect is very limited but it is there). Juergen A.
